/ˈspeʃəl ˌredʒɪˈstreɪʃən/ – Phrase
Definition: việc đăng ký cử tri của một cuộc bầu cử cụ thể.
A more thorough explanation: Special registration refers to a process by which individuals are required to register with a government agency or authority for a specific purpose or under certain circumstances, often involving additional requirements or restrictions beyond standard registration procedures.
Example: The special registration period for voting in the upcoming election will begin next week.
